ビットコイン初心者のための基本用語解説
ビットコインは、2009年にサトシ・ナカモトと名乗る人物(またはグループ)によって考案された、世界初の分散型暗号資産です。中央銀行などの管理主体が存在せず、P2Pネットワークを通じて取引が検証・記録される点が特徴です。本稿では、ビットコインを理解するための基本的な用語を解説します。初心者の方でも分かりやすいように、専門用語を丁寧に解説し、ビットコインの世界への第一歩をサポートします。
1. ブロックチェーン (Blockchain)
ブロックチェーンは、ビットコインの中核となる技術です。取引履歴を記録する「ブロック」を鎖のように繋げたもので、各ブロックには、前のブロックのハッシュ値が含まれています。これにより、データの改ざんが極めて困難になり、高いセキュリティを確保しています。ブロックチェーンは、分散型台帳技術(DLT: Distributed Ledger Technology)の一種であり、ビットコイン以外にも様々な分野での応用が期待されています。
2. 暗号資産 (Crypto Asset) / 仮想通貨 (Virtual Currency)
暗号資産は、暗号技術を用いてセキュリティを確保し、価値を保存・移転するデジタルデータです。ビットコインはその代表的な例です。仮想通貨は、法律上の定義が国によって異なり、必ずしも暗号資産と同義ではありません。日本では、暗号資産交換業法に基づき、暗号資産交換業者が規制されています。
3. ウォレット (Wallet)
ウォレットは、ビットコインを保管・管理するためのソフトウェアまたはハードウェアです。ウォレットには、ビットコインの送受信に必要な秘密鍵と公開鍵が格納されています。ウォレットの種類には、ソフトウェアウォレット(デスクトップウォレット、モバイルウォレット、ウェブウォレット)とハードウェアウォレットがあります。ハードウェアウォレットは、オフラインで秘密鍵を保管するため、セキュリティが高いとされています。
4. 秘密鍵 (Private Key)
秘密鍵は、ビットコインの所有権を証明するための重要な情報です。秘密鍵を知っている人だけが、ビットコインを移動させることができます。秘密鍵は絶対に他人に知られないように厳重に管理する必要があります。秘密鍵を紛失すると、ビットコインを失う可能性があります。
5. 公開鍵 (Public Key)
公開鍵は、秘密鍵から生成される情報で、ビットコインのアドレスとして使用されます。公開鍵は、誰でも知ることができます。ビットコインを受け取る際には、相手に自分の公開鍵(アドレス)を伝えます。
6. アドレス (Address)
アドレスは、ビットコインを受け取るための宛先です。公開鍵から生成され、英数字の文字列で構成されます。ビットコインを送金する際には、相手のアドレスを正確に入力する必要があります。アドレスの入力ミスは、ビットコインの損失につながる可能性があります。
7. マイニング (Mining)
マイニングは、ビットコインの取引を検証し、ブロックチェーンに新しいブロックを追加する作業です。マイナーと呼ばれる人々が、高性能なコンピュータを用いて複雑な計算問題を解き、その報酬としてビットコインを得ます。マイニングは、ビットコインのセキュリティを維持するために不可欠な役割を果たしています。
8. PoW (Proof of Work)
PoWは、マイニングで使用されるコンセンサスアルゴリズムの一つです。マイナーは、計算問題を解くことで、取引の正当性を証明します。PoWは、セキュリティが高い反面、大量の電力消費が課題となっています。
9. ハッシュ関数 (Hash Function)
ハッシュ関数は、任意のデータを固定長の文字列に変換する関数です。ビットコインでは、SHA-256というハッシュ関数が使用されています。ハッシュ関数は、データの改ざんを検知するために使用されます。入力データが少しでも異なると、出力されるハッシュ値も大きく変化します。
10. P2Pネットワーク (Peer-to-Peer Network)
P2Pネットワークは、中央サーバーを介さずに、コンピュータ同士が直接通信するネットワークです。ビットコインは、P2Pネットワーク上で動作しており、取引の検証やブロックチェーンの共有が行われます。P2Pネットワークは、検閲耐性があり、システム全体の可用性が高いという特徴があります。
11. 取引手数料 (Transaction Fee)
取引手数料は、ビットコインの取引を処理するために支払う費用です。取引手数料は、取引のサイズやネットワークの混雑状況によって変動します。取引手数料が高いほど、取引が優先的に処理される可能性が高くなります。
12. 難易度調整 (Difficulty Adjustment)
難易度調整は、ビットコインのマイニングの難易度を調整する仕組みです。ビットコインのブロック生成時間は、約10分間になるように調整されます。ネットワークのハッシュレート(マイニング能力の合計)が変化すると、難易度が調整されます。
13. ハードフォーク (Hard Fork)
ハードフォークは、ビットコインのプロトコルを変更する行為です。ハードフォークによって、新しい暗号資産が誕生する場合があります。ハードフォークは、コミュニティの合意に基づいて行われる必要があります。
14. ソフトフォーク (Soft Fork)
ソフトフォークは、ビットコインのプロトコルを後方互換性を保ちながら変更する行為です。ソフトフォークは、ハードフォークよりもリスクが低いとされています。
15. SegWit (Segregated Witness)
SegWitは、ビットコインのブロックサイズを拡大するための技術の一つです。SegWitを導入することで、取引手数料を削減し、ネットワークの処理能力を向上させることができます。
16. ライトニングネットワーク (Lightning Network)
ライトニングネットワークは、ビットコインのスケーラビリティ問題を解決するためのオフチェーンスケーリングソリューションです。ライトニングネットワークを使用することで、高速かつ低コストでビットコインの取引を行うことができます。
17. 51%攻撃 (51% Attack)
51%攻撃は、マイナーがネットワーク全体のハッシュレートの51%以上を掌握し、取引の改ざんや二重支払いを可能にする攻撃です。51%攻撃は、ビットコインのセキュリティを脅かす可能性があります。
18. 冷蔵保存 (Cold Storage)
冷蔵保存は、ビットコインをオフラインで保管する方法です。ハードウェアウォレットやペーパーウォレットを使用することで、ハッキングのリスクを低減することができます。長期間ビットコインを保管する場合には、冷蔵保存が推奨されます。
19. 熱い保存 (Hot Storage)
熱い保存は、ビットコインをオンラインで保管する方法です。ソフトウェアウォレットや取引所のウォレットを使用することで、手軽にビットコインを取引することができます。ただし、ハッキングのリスクが高いため、少額のビットコインを保管する程度に留めるべきです。
20. KYC (Know Your Customer)
KYCは、顧客確認のことです。暗号資産交換業者では、マネーロンダリングやテロ資金供与を防止するために、顧客の本人確認を行う必要があります。KYCは、暗号資産市場の健全性を維持するために重要な役割を果たしています。
まとめ
本稿では、ビットコインを理解するための基本的な用語を解説しました。ビットコインは、複雑な技術に基づいていますが、基本的な用語を理解することで、その仕組みを理解することができます。ビットコインは、まだ発展途上の技術であり、今後も様々な変化が予想されます。常に最新の情報を収集し、ビットコインの世界を深く理解していくことが重要です。ビットコインは、単なる投資対象としてだけでなく、新しい金融システムを構築するための可能性を秘めています。ビットコインの未来に注目し、積極的に関わっていくことをお勧めします。